Perfectly situated, the village of Kilmington is just a mile away from the cottage and boasts two local pubs serving food, and a farm shop selling local produce. Slightly further away, Hugh Fearnley Whittingstall's acclaimed River Cottage restaurant can be found in Axminster (3 miles) as well as a weekly market and variety of shops. Alternatively, head towards the world renowned Jurassic Coast and visit the seaside towns of Beer and Lyme Regis, both within an 8 mile drive, or spend an afternoon exploring the Axe Estuary Nature Reserve. Other attractions and places of interest accessible from here include Abbotsbury Swannery (24 miles), Bicton Park (18 miles), the cathedral city of Exeter (23 miles) and numerous National Trust properties. Step inside this unique property, that s design emulates from its natural surroundings, via a set of French doors and into the cosy and welcoming lounge. Here, comfortable seating is arranged around a warming wood burner and Smart TV, providing a lovely place to relax after a busy day exploring. From here, head further inside and into the beautiful kitchen/diner which also includes a set of French doors leading to the outside, meaning that you can dine alfresco with ease during warm weather. The handcrafted kitchen blends traditional craftsmanship with stylish convenience, and boasts a great selection of appliances including an electric oven and hob, microwave, fridge/freezer and a dishwasher. Located just beyond this, at the base of the stairs, is a handy utility room with a washing machine and ground floor WC, which also provides a useful place to store coats and outdoor equipment. Venture up the feature, spiral cob staircase and onto the first floor where you will find yourself on the spacious landing which leads to the two gorgeous bedrooms. The first and larger of the two rooms boasts a king size bed and an opening large window to a pretty Juliet balcony. The second, a smaller but equally as impeccably styled room, offers a super king 'zip and link' bed which can be made in to a twin. Completing the offering inside the property, located in between the bedrooms, is a stylish bathroom with a roll top bath, separate shower, marble sink and WC. Heading outside, further highlights await in the shape of the delightful, enclosed courtyard garden, presented with garden furniture and a BBQ. This provides a perfect venue for laidback meals in the open air, or a morning coffee before heading out for the day. Further to this, guests also benefit from access to a secluded area with seating and a fire pit, perfect for stargazing on a clear night. Private off road parking for two cars is also provided.
